We redesigned Thermoast into a consistent scheduling experience that users can act on instantly.

Through 9 iterations, we transformed insights into

40+ design assets and improved

user confidence end-to-end.

The final prototype scored 7+ satisfaction and strengthened the business path for retention and premium growth.

As Design Lead, I drove the schedule overhaul and built the innovation modules end-to-end. I aligned direction with a design partner through critique loops, and partnered with PMs to turn requirements into crisp, user-centric decisions.

Product Constraints

The redesign was constrained by the physical characteristics

of the Nest Thermostat hardware:



  • 2.0" Round Screen: Prioritizing "glanceable" content over data density.


  • Rotary & Push Input: Linear navigation via a physical ring and button.


  • Integrated Sensors: Using proximity/light for "hands-free" automated UI.


  • Zero-Cost Solution: 100% software-driven; no hardware modifications.

Sleep apps provide metrics but don’t let users control the environment.

Thermoast unifies sleep stages and temperature in a single timeline, highlighting a personal comfort range for the next night.

Thermostats provide control but don’t explain how nightly temperature patterns relate to sleep outcomes.

For the Temp × Sleep feature,

the business upside is twofold:

Premium differentiation: 


Strengthens the Pro / high-end

positioning with a clearer story


Engagement → monetization:


User more frequent opens for sleep analysis create opportunities for contextual promotion and traffic-based monetization

 (e.g., recommending Thermoast-related upgrades or services in the sleep experience APP).
